WebA brief summary of the California State Plan is included in the Code of Federal Regulations at 29 CFR 1952.7. Federal OSHA retains the authority to promulgate, modify, or revoke occupational safety and health standards under Section 6 of the OSH Act. In the event that Federal OSHA resumes enforcement, those federal standards will be enforced. WebOSHA Training Institute Education Centers in California. The OSHA Training Institute (OTI) Education Centers are a national network of non-profit organizations authorized by OSHA to provide occupational safety and health training to all workers and employers.
